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To minimize the slippage of a rolling wheel, prevent the wear, deformation or breakage of a projection, and resist the temperature rise of the projection surface by the friction in traveling by exposing a heat resisting thermosetting member having low frictional performance on the contact surface with the other member of the projection. SOLUTION: A circular sectional bar-like body 31 is buried in a projection 2 toward the lateral direction of a rubber crawler. The bar-like body 31 is made of bakelite, and both ends 311 , 312 are exposed to the lateral side surfaces 4, 5 of the projection 2. To bury the bar-like body 31 into the projection 2, the bar-like body 31 is fitted into the recessed part of a metal mold for forming the projection 2, and a rubber 1 constituting the base of the rubber crawler is filled into the metal mold. The both are cured and adhered by the adhering force in the curing of the rubber 1, and integrated together. Both the ends 311 , 312 of the bar-like body 31 are exposed to both the end surfaces 4, 5 of the projection 2, and make contact in the contact or collision with a rolling wheel, idler or sprocket. Since the bar-like body 31 is low frictional, the slippage with the rolling wheel is reduced, the wear or breakage is minimized, and the traveling resistance is also remarkably reduced.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a rubber crawler used for a traveling portion of a vehicle, and more particularly to an improvement in a protrusion protruding from an inner peripheral surface of a rubber crawler.

Description of the Related Art In general, a projection is continuously formed on an inner peripheral surface of a rubber crawler in a longitudinal direction thereof, and the projection is used for transmitting a driving force from a sprocket, or is connected to a rolling wheel. It functions as a slip-off prevention. In particular, in order to prevent disengagement from the rolling wheel, if the rubber crawler receives a lateral force and is relatively displaced from the rolling wheel, the rolling wheel contacts with the protrusion. The collision is repeated, and the deviation is to be returned to the original state. For this reason, a frictional force is applied to the projection, and the wheel is separated from the rolling wheel, and further, wear and breakage occur.

14 to 15 show the inner peripheral surface of the rubber crawler 11 in such a state. FIG. 14 shows a shape in which a pair of protrusions 12 and 12 project from an endless rubber elastic body. The rolling wheel 20 normally rolls over the protrusions 12, 12, but when a deviation occurs between the rubber crawler 11 and the rolling wheel 20, the rolling wheel 20 is indicated by a dotted line (one side Contacting and colliding with the projections 12, 12 as shown in FIG. For this reason, a large frictional force is applied to the protrusions 12 and 12, especially on the outer side surfaces thereof, and derailment between the protrusions 12 and 12 is likely to occur, resulting in wear or damage in some cases.

On the other hand, FIG. 15 shows a rubber crawler in which a single projection 12 is projected. Again, when the rolling wheel 20 is displaced from the normal rolling position, the rolling wheel 20 and the projection 12 are also shown. As shown by the dotted line, contact and collision are repeated to prevent deviation.In this case as well, derailment with the rolling wheels easily occurs, and in some cases wear and damage may occur. Becomes Further, the protrusion 12 engages with a sprocket (not shown), and when the driving force is transmitted, the sprocket pin and the protrusion 12 always rub against each other. Therefore, the protrusion 12 is deformed especially at the root portion. Therefore, not only is there a tendency for derailment to occur with the rolling wheels, but also for easy wear or damage to this portion, especially when the projection 12 is made of rubber.

[0005] Furthermore, when the rolling wheel 20 and the projection 12 come into contact with each other or collide with each other, a large running resistance is generated, resulting in a loss of energy.

S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ION The present invention has been made in view of the above-mentioned conventional techniques.
The protrusion that protrudes on the inner peripheral surface of the la has a special structure to reduce the occurrence of derailment with the rolling wheel and to protect the protrusion from wear, deformation, damage, etc. In order to solve the problem, a member that can withstand the temperature rise on the surface of the protrusion caused by friction during traveling is integrally coupled with the protrusion.

DISCLOSURE OF THE INVENTION As a result of intensive studies to achieve the above object, the present invention has been improved with the projection having the following structure. That is, the gist of the present invention is to form a rubber lug on the outer peripheral surface of the endless rubber elastic body,
A rubber crawler having a protrusion provided on the inner peripheral surface for transmitting a driving force or for preventing disengagement from a rolling wheel, wherein the contact surface of the protrusion with another member has low friction performance and heat resistance. It is a rubber crawler characterized by exposing a thermosetting resin member.

Preferably, a thermosetting resin member is set in a mold for forming a rubber crawler, and then a rubber material is filled to provide a rubber crawler in which the thermosetting resin member is integrally formed with a protrusion. To do. The thermosetting resin member preferably has a property that the thermal decomposition temperature is 200 ° C. or higher.

The effect is made more remarkable by selecting a resin member that can withstand the temperature rise on the surface of the protrusion caused by friction. That is, using a vehicle equipped with four wheels of a protrusion driving type rubber crawler, a turning test was conducted at a radius of 15 mm and a speed of 25 km per hour, and the temperature of the protrusion surface was measured every 10 minutes of running time.
It was found that the temperature rose to 180 ° C. or higher after 40 minutes of running time. Therefore, in the present invention, it has a low friction property and has a thermal decomposition temperature (temperature at which it chemically changes in the short term) of 20.
A thermosetting resin having a so-called heat resistance of 0 ° C. or higher is adopted here.

Examples of the thermosetting resin particularly selected in the present invention include phenol resin (Bakelite), urea resin, melamine resin, unsaturated polyester resin, allyl resin and epoxy resin. Further, a resin reinforced with cotton, paper, cloth, glass fiber, asbestos or the like can be applied to these resins. As the shape of the resin member, a member having any shape such as a rod-shaped body, a plate-shaped body, a cylindrical body, a plate-shaped body or a dumbbell-shaped body may be used.

D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ENTS The present invention will be described below in more detail with reference to embodiments. FIG. 1 is a first example of the rubber crawler of the present invention, and is a perspective view showing only the protrusion 2, and FIG. 2 is a side view thereof. The protrusion 2 has a height (H) of 30 mm from the inner peripheral surface of the rubber 1 constituting the rubber crawler, and the length (L 1 ) in the width direction of the rubber crawler is 60 mm.
The length (L 2 ) of the top in the longitudinal direction of the la is 25 mm,
The length (L 2 ) of the base was 55 mm. And protrusion 2
The left and right side surfaces 4, 5 and the front and rear surfaces 7, 8 are configured with a desired perspective angle.

Now, a rod-shaped body 3 having a circular cross section with a diameter of 20 mm
1 was embedded in the protrusion 2 in the width direction of the rubber crawler. The rod-shaped body 3 1 is made of Becklite, and both ends 3 11 and 3 12 thereof are exposed on the left and right side surfaces 4 and 5 of the protrusion 2. To embed the rod-shaped body 3 in the protrusion 2, a mold having a recessed portion that forms the protrusion 2 is used.
It is obtained by inserting 1 and filling the mold with the rubber material 1 which forms the base of the rubber crawler while maintaining this state, and both are vulcanized and bonded by the adhesive force when the rubber 1 is vulcanized. It is to be integrated. Of course, in some cases, one type or a combination of phenol type, epoxy type and rubber type adhesives may be used for vulcanization adhesion.

As shown in the figure, both side surfaces 4, 5 of the protrusion 2 are
Since both ends 3 11 and 3 12 of the rod-shaped body 3 1 are exposed at the time of contact or collision with a rolling wheel, an idler, a sprocket, or the like (not shown), they are lower than the characteristics of the rod-shaped body 3 1. Since it is frictional, the number of wheels removed from the rolling wheels is reduced, wear and damage are reduced, and running resistance is significantly reduced.

FIG. 3 shows a second example of the rubber crawler of the present invention, in which a disk-shaped resin 3 2 (made by Becklite) having a diameter of 20 mm and a thickness of 5 mm is formed on the side surfaces 4 and 5 of the projection 2 on one side. It is buried so that it is exposed. This is also one in which the resin 3 2 is set to wear vulcanization in a recess in the mold of the vulcanization rubber material 1.

FIG. 4 is a perspective view of a protrusion 2 showing a third example of the rubber crawler of the present invention, and FIG. 5 is a side view thereof. In this example, a flat resin plate 3 3 (made by Becklite)
Is embedded in the center of the protrusion 2 in the width direction, and both ends 3 31 and 3 32 thereof are exposed to the left and right side faces 4 and 5 of the protrusion 2. The thickness of the plate-shaped resin plate 3 3 is 10 mm, which also will be integrated by vulcanization between the rubber material 1. In addition, in this example, the protrusion 2 has front and rear surfaces 7, 8
Is a two-step inclined surface. The outline of the protrusion 2 is such that the width of the top surface in the longitudinal direction of the rubber crawler is 10 mm, the width of the base is 60 mm, the height (H) is 40 mm, and the height is 15 m.
A bent portion 9 is formed at front and rear surfaces 7 and 8 at a position of m.

In each of these examples, the surface of the protrusion 2 may be protected by another reinforcing material. In FIG. 6, the reinforcing canvas 10 which is continuous or discontinuous in the longitudinal direction of the rubber crawler is shown in FIG. -To cover the inner surface of the la and the surface of the protrusion 2 thereof. This canvas may be either crimping or non-crimping, and these are also those in which a canvas is set in a mold and vulcanized and bonded to the rubber material 1.

FIG. 7 shows the inner peripheral surface of the rubber crawler of the fourth example of the present invention, FIG. 8 is a cross section taken along the line AA of FIG. 7, and FIG. 9 is a cross section taken along the line BB of FIG. Is shown. In the this example, the resin member 3 4 has a low friction formed in a cross shape is obtained by integrated into the projections 2, both side surfaces 4 and 5 of the projections 2, the front and rear surfaces 7,8 The surface of the member 3 4 is exposed. Of course, it may be exposed on the top surface 6. The protrusion 2 thus configured has an effect of preventing abrasion and damage of the protrusion 2 when it comes into contact with the sprocket, as in the case of contact and collision with the wheel. In the this member 3 4, it is sufficient to set in this Matakin type, in some cases, it may be a low friction member that is divided into four.

The resin member having a low friction can be applied to other parts of the rubber crawler, for example, it can be applied to the rolling surface of the rolling wheel on the inner peripheral surface of the rubber crawler. It is also possible to use this between the pair of protrusions. In some cases, this low friction member can be used on the sprocket side.

Test Example 1 is an example of only a rubber material in which no resin is embedded, Test Example 2 is a resin of ultra high molecular weight polyethylene, and all of these Test Examples are examples in which the resin specified in the present invention is not used. is there. Test Example 3 is an example in which the resin specified in the present invention is used, and a rubber chlore is obtained by using a Bakelite resin containing cloth.

【0024】(試験法)試験法は前記した方法と同様で
あり、突起駆動型ゴムクロ−ラを四輪に装着した車両を
半径15mm、時速25kmで旋回走行試験を実施し、
走行10分毎に突起の状況を確認した。そして、突起の
側面摩耗状況の試験方法は、走行10分毎に突起頂部か
ら30mmの所(L1 mm)の長さ(L2 mm)を実測
し、(L1 −L2 mm)を摩耗幅とした。
(Test Method) The test method is the same as that described above, and a vehicle equipped with four wheel drive projection type rubber crawlers is subjected to a turning test at a radius of 15 mm and a speed of 25 km / hour.
The condition of the protrusion was checked every 10 minutes of running. Then, the test method of the side surface wear condition of the protrusion is that the length (L 2 mm) at a position 30 mm (L 1 mm) from the top of the protrusion is measured every 10 minutes of running, and (L 1 −L 2 mm) is worn. As a result of the test, in Test Example 1 in which no resin material is used, the wear has already started 10 minutes after the start of the running test, and the wear has a width of 17 mm after 60 minutes.
In Test Example 1 using the ultra high molecular weight polyethylene rod, it was confirmed that the resin rod was softened 30 minutes after the start of the running test and further abrasion was generated.
The amount of wear was 8 mm.

【0028】しかるに、本発明の試験例である試験例3
にあっては、走行試験開始後60分後にあっても突起側
面の摩耗は見られず、又、走行試験開始後40分後にあ
って突起の表面温度が180℃を越えたが樹脂に軟化の
発生は見られなかった。摩耗の発生もなかった。
However, Test Example 3 which is a test example of the present invention
There was no abrasion on the side surface of the protrusion even 60 minutes after the start of the running test, and the surface temperature of the protrusion exceeded 180 ° C 40 minutes after the start of the running test, but the resin softened. No outbreak was observed. There was no occurrence of wear.
